Big Q & Specific Q
• Does the views of the opposite sex effect ones decision
• Would females tend to buy a certain dress more, if they are informed that guys prefer it better?
![Page 3: Which Dress will you buy? Christine Song(11),Jasmyne Marshall, Morgan cannon.](https://reader036.fdocuments.in/reader036/viewer/2022070414/5697c00c1a28abf838cc8b7e/html5/thumbnails/3.jpg)
Tentative hypothesis
• YES THEY WILL!
• Many girls will tend to pick a certain dress out of the 5 dresses given, if they are informed that, males prefer the certain dress.
![Page 4: Which Dress will you buy? Christine Song(11),Jasmyne Marshall, Morgan cannon.](https://reader036.fdocuments.in/reader036/viewer/2022070414/5697c00c1a28abf838cc8b7e/html5/thumbnails/4.jpg)
Procedure1
• -Put 5 dresses on a board and ask 25 girls (5 girls each from age 14 to 18) to put a sticker on which dress they would buy.
• (14 year old: yellow 15year old:red 16year old:blue 17 year old: black 18year old: green)(This is to make it easier to analyze data)

procedure 2
• Make a same board with the same 5 dresses, BUT this time below the dresses, show the percentage of how many guys prefer the certain dress. Than, repeat the same procedure in part1

Compare
• In Korea: Before informed-4, After informed-9
• In Texas: Before informed- 0 After informed-7
• In both groups, there was an increase of choice of dress#5.
• (Korea:20%, Texas:35%)
![Page 11: Which Dress will you buy? Christine Song(11),Jasmyne Marshall, Morgan cannon.](https://reader036.fdocuments.in/reader036/viewer/2022070414/5697c00c1a28abf838cc8b7e/html5/thumbnails/11.jpg)
Analysis
• Females are influenced by the views of males, and are willing to change their decisions based on what males would think of them.
![Page 12: Which Dress will you buy? Christine Song(11),Jasmyne Marshall, Morgan cannon.](https://reader036.fdocuments.in/reader036/viewer/2022070414/5697c00c1a28abf838cc8b7e/html5/thumbnails/12.jpg)
Flaws
• Girls may have truly thought that the certain dress was more attractive
• Not taken seriously(conversation among friends while decision)
• Minor miscommunication with group members
